How Youll Make an Impact

As a Mechanical Integrity Leader you will drive the implementation of a world-class Mechanical Integrity Program while fostering a culture focused on eliminating Loss of Primary Containment (LOPC) events ensuring regulatory compliance and improving asset reliability and availability. You will play a critical role in ensuring the site achieves its business objectives through strategic asset management risk reduction and cross-functional this role you will:

  • Lead the implementation and continuous improvement of the site Mechanical Integrity Program ensuring alignment across Maintenance Engineering Operations and Capital Project teams.
  • Own and manage the 5-year asset strategy driving long-term asset health compliance and operational performance.
  • Drive objective setting performance reviews and continuous improvement initiatives to strengthen mechanical integrity and asset reliability.
  • Develop and implement comprehensive Mechanical Integrity programs utilizing industry standards and best practices including:
    • APIand 653
    • ASME BPVC PCC-1 PCC-2 B31.1 and B31.3
    • NBIC
    • NFPA
    • Other applicable RAGAGEP standards
  • Develop and oversee asset care strategies and lifecycle management programs for fixed equipment including:
    • Pressure Vessels
    • Heat Exchangers
    • Storage Tanks
    • Piping Systems
    • Pressure Relief Devices
    • Boilers
    • Heaters and Incinerators
    • FRP Equipment
    • Glass-Lined Equipment
  • Track and report key Mechanical Integrity metrics including PM compliance deficient equipment inspection deferments temporary repairs LOPCs and CAPA completion rates adjusting strategies based on performance trends.
  • Drive the adoption and utilization of advanced inspection technologies such as advanced NDE methods rope access drones crawlers and other emerging technologies to improve inspection efficiency and effectiveness.
  • Lead the application of Risk-Based Inspection (RBI) Fitness-for-Service (FFS) Damage Mechanism Assessments (DMA) Root Cause Analysis (RCA) and failure analysis methodologies.
  • Champion the site Pressure Relief Device Program including testing strategies inspection frequencies repair management compliance and long-term asset strategy.
  • Lead and maintain key Mechanical Integrity programs including:
    • PM Compliance
    • SPCC Tank Inspection Program
    • Equipment Criticality Assessments
    • PCMS Inspection Data Management System
    • Inspection Deferment Process
    • Corrective and Preventive Action (CAPA) Management
    • Corrosion Under Insulation (CUI) Program
    • Equipment Low Remaining Life Program
  • Support Capital Projects Turnarounds (TARs) and Maintenance activities through planning budgeting scope development and execution support.
  • Ensure Mechanical Integrity principles and industry best practices are embedded within capital projects influencing design construction and commissioning decisions.

Required Qualifications

  • Bachelors degree in Engineering from an accredited university.
  • 8 years of Mechanical Integrity or Reliability Engineering experience within a chemical manufacturing environment.
  • 3 years of leadership experience with demonstrated ability to drive change and influence organizational outcomes.
  • Strong knowledge of industry codes standards and certifications including:
    • API 510
    • API 570
    • API 653
    • NBIC
    • ASME Boiler & Pressure Vessel Code (BPVC)
    • NFPA
  • Experience with inspection repair alteration design troubleshooting and fitness-for-service evaluations for:
    • Pressure Vessels
    • Storage Tanks
    • Heat Exchangers
    • Piping Systems
    • Pressure Relief Devices
  • Strong understanding of corrosion mechanisms metallurgy welding failure analysis and suitability-for-service evaluations within a chemical plant environment.
  • Proven track record of leading implementing and improving Mechanical Integrity Programs within OSHA 1910.119 (PSM) covered facilities.
  • Experience with equipment fabrication NBIC repairs and alterations and Vessel Repair (VR) programs.
  • Strong analytical problem-solving and risk-based decision-making skills.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Knowledge of Texas jurisdictional inspection and regulatory requirements.
